This uncirculated 2,000 Vanuatu Vatu note is a standard circulation banknote issued by the Reserve Bank of Vanuatu. It is a green, blue, orange, and brown polymer note that is dated 2014, bears the signatures of Simeon Malachi Athy and Maki Simelum, and measures 145 mm x 65 mm. Its obverse side features a conch shell, a waterway, a Melanesian chief, and the map of the Vanuatu Islands. Its reverse side shows the map of Vanuatu Islands, a flower, three birds, and a conch shell. Though the note does not have a security thread, it has a watermark of the bank logo.
